Every year on January 15, Indian Army Day is observed in honor of Field Marshal Kodandera M. Cariappa, who took over as the first Commander-in-Chief of the Indian Army on this day in 1949 from the last British Army Chief, General Francis Butcher. India will commemorate the 75th anniversary of Indian Army Day in 2023.

The day is commemorated by various parades, medal presentations, and cultural military displays in New Delhi and at all Army Command headquarters.

Celebrations of Indian Army Day

The day is observed by all army command headquarters in New Delhi to honor Indian army soldiers who lived, survived, and died while defending the country’s independence and dignity. Following the homage, grand celebrations are held across the country.

To commemorate the day, various parades, including military displays, are held yearly at Cariappa Parade Ground in Delhi Cantonment. It exemplifies the army’s strengths, bravery, daring, and devotion to the country.
Soldiers are awarded gallantry awards and Sena Models such as the Param Vir Chakra and the Vir Chakra, among others, for their bravery and courageous acts. On this occasion, the Indian Army Chief salutes the parade. The day is observed in memory of the valiant Indian soldiers who died while fighting for their country.
